Indian and South Asian matrimony in the Netherlands

What is specific about looking for a serious relationship or marriage as a South Asian adult in the Netherlands.

Written by the Lagnora team at Sagous B.V. · Reviewed 26 Aug 2026

The short answer

The Netherlands has a long-established South Asian population and a large, recent wave of Indian professionals in and around Amsterdam, Amstelveen, Eindhoven, Utrecht, Rotterdam, The Hague and Delft. For matrimony that means a real local pool but a very spread-out one, so a platform matters more than a neighbourhood network. Dutch and EU data protection rules also give you concrete rights over what a platform stores about you.

A real pool, spread thin

Two groups overlap here. There is a settled South Asian community with roots going back decades, including a large Dutch Indian population of Surinamese descent, and there is a much newer group of Indian and other South Asian professionals who arrived for work in technology, engineering, research and healthcare, clustered around Amsterdam, Amstelveen, Eindhoven and the Utrecht and Rotterdam and The Hague corridor.

For anyone looking for marriage, that means the pool exists but is not concentrated in one neighbourhood or one temple network. Two people who would get on well can live forty minutes apart and never meet. This is the gap a platform can genuinely close, and it is why Lagnora asks for your city at signup and groups early invitations by area.

What Dutch and EU rules give you

Under the GDPR, as implemented in the Netherlands through the AVG, you can ask any platform what it holds about you, ask for a copy, ask for corrections, and ask for deletion. Sensitive information — religion, caste, health, sexual orientation — has extra protection, which is why Lagnora treats those fields as voluntary and never infers them.

Two practical consequences on this website: the marketing site runs cookieless analytics and shows no cookie banner because there is nothing to consent to, and the privacy page names the company, the address and how to reach a human. If a service cannot tell you those things, that is your answer.
